danoise is used for these senses in English:
- Dane A person of Danish descent.
- Danish Of or pertaining to Denmark.
- Danish pastry A sweet and flaky yeast-raised roll made from a dough using butter or margarine and filled with remonce (butter and sugar) or custard.
- danish Danish pastry, light sweet yeast-raised roll usually filled with fruit or cheese.
Dane — full definition
- noun A person from Denmark, or a member of the Scandinavian ethnic group native to it.
- noun In English history, one of the Viking raiders and settlers from Scandinavia who invaded parts of England from the 8th century onward.
Danish — full definition
- adj Relating to Denmark, its people, language, or culture.
- name The language spoken in Denmark.
- noun A sweet, flaky pastry, often filled with fruit or cheese.
